WebIreland has a total area of 84,421 km 2 (32,595 sq mi), of which the Republic of Ireland occupies 83 percent. Ireland and Great Britain, together with many nearby smaller islands, are known collectively as the British Isles.

Hospitality endures here, a legacy from Celtic times when ... hazel potter obituary alton bay nhWebOct 22, 2024 · 82.2% of the population of Ireland comprises the ethnic Irish. People from other white, Asian, and black ethnic backgrounds represent 9.5%, 2.1%, and 1.4% of the population, respectively.
